Basic Information

Product Name Spiro[Bicyclo[2.2.1]Heptane-2,3-Oxetane], 3-Methyl- (9Ci)
CAS No. 355833-76-0
Molecular Formula C9H14O
Molecular Weight 138.21 g/mol

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). This compound may be sensitive to moisture and prolonged exposure to air; for long-term storage, consider under an inert atmosphere.
